The United Arab Emirates (UAE) has pledged to invest $1.4 trillion in the US over the next decade, marking one of the largest foreign investment commitments in US history. The investment will focus on AI infrastructure, semiconductors, energy, and American manufacturing. This commitment was made during a meeting between the UAE National Security Advisor and US President Trump.
